A solid game. A few suggestions for making it great:
-Penalize the player for dying, such as halving the bits or at least not allowing the player to collect bits. Otherwise an easy strategy to win is to activate zero-writes and die all day.
-Having three zero writes is a bit too powerful. Decrease the max number of zero writes to 1 or 2 at most and/or do not auto-collect the bits.
-A bug forced my player to one direction until I hit the direction again. I'm guessing you know about this by now.
Loved the dialog, humor, and emotion to the story. Would like to see what you can create next.
